In "Big, Bigger, Biggest: The Frog That Tried to Outgrow the Elephant," a determined frog embarks on a whimsical journey to prove he can grow larger than his friend, the elephant. As he hatches a series of outrageous plans to increase his size, the frog learns valuable lessons about acceptance, friendship, and recognizing one's own strengths. Through vibrant illustrations and engaging storytelling, this tale highlights the importance of appreciating oneself rather than competing with others. The story takes readers on a delightful adventure filled with humor and heartwarming moments that resonate with both children and adults. JANE KURTZ lives in Portland, Oregon. She has written more than thirty fiction and nonfiction books for children, including Lanie and Lanie's Real Adventure from the American Girl Today series, Anna Was Here, and River Friendly, River Wild, a story in verse for which she received a Golden Kite award.
